WebGenerally speaking, the harder the wood the easier it is to finish and polish. Harder woods create good, solid long-lasting joinery in furniture. The hardness of wood varies with the direction of the wood grain, and varies from piece to piece. So a Janka rating is an average of numerous tests performed on all directions and numerous pieces. Add to Favorites Unfinished Wood Knob British - 1-1/4 inch in diameter … WebA ply refers to a layer of veneer used to create plywood’s various thicknesses. More ply creates a thicker and stronger board. Plywood has an odd number of plies and needs at least three plies. Although specialty plywood can have any number of plies above three, most plywood is categorized as 3-ply, 5-ply or multi-ply. Web1/4 in. x 3.5 in. x 8 ft. Cedar Board V-Plank (6-Pieces) - 14 sq. ft.
